Submission guidelines

The Louden Singletree magazine accepts two submission types — literature and visual art pieces — and each has their own set of guidelines for submission.

To ensure your work will be reviewed by the Louden Singletree editorial committee, please follow the submission guidelines below.

If you are a current UFV student, member of the UFV staff or faculty, or a member of the UFV alumni association, you are invited to submit your work.

Third-party or previously published works will not be considered, that includes any work previously published on other websites, blogs, and/or social media.

Literature submission guidelines

Please ensure that the following guidelines are followed or your documents will be returned to you rather than submitted:

Document types

Submitted files must be in MS Word document (.doc or .docx). Files should be named according to the following convention: “First initial Last Name Title”, ie: JSmithFlowersarePretty.doc.

Submission format

The Louden Singletree accepts original, unpublished fiction and non-fiction and poetry.

  • Please use 12-point Times New Roman font.
  • Text should be single-spaced. Exceptions are made for structural poetry.
  • To assist in adjudicative neutrality, please do not indicate your name anywhere else in the document.
  • You may provide a description of your work or artist statement at the beginning of your document, however, this is not required.

Note: Please expect some copy-editing if your submission is chosen for publication. However, to ensure your piece is selected, be sure to proofread and avoid any grammar errors to the best of your ability.

Visual arts submission guidelines

Visual Arts submissions are comprised of two parts:

  1. An artist statement of approximately 200-500 words 
  2. A visual image

Please ensure that the following guidelines are followed or your documents will be returned to you rather than submitted:

Document types

Submitted files must be in MS Word document (.doc or .docx). Files should be named according to the following convention: “First initial Last Name Title”, ie: JSmithFlowersarePretty.doc.

Submission format

  • Include your artist statement (approximately 200-500 words) at the beginning of your document and use 12-point Times New Roman font, single-spaced.
  • Submitted images may be drawings, paintings, photographs, documentation photographs of three dimensional work, graphic stories/excerpts from graphic novels* (of up to four pages) or mixed media. Both colour and black & white submissions are accepted.
  • To assist in adjudicative neutrality, please do not indicate your name anywhere else in the document.

*Please note that due to printing costs, full-colour graphic submissions might be printed in grayscale and should be rendered compatible for such a possibility.

If your submission is chosen for publishing, we will contact you and have you send us a fresh copy of your image file. The visual art files selected for publishing must be in .jpeg format and able to be reduced to 8 1/2" x 14" or smaller (absolutely no less than 300 dpi). This will ensure your piece is printed at the highest quality possible.
